It is in Cholula that the largest Aztec temple, the Great Pyramid of Cholula, is located. It is also called Tlachiualtepetl, which means "man-made mountain."
As with other pyramids, the history of the Great Pyramid is shrouded in many secrets and mysteries. According to some sources, the construction of the pyramid began around the first century BC and continued until the eighth century AD. According to other studies, the beginning of construction began in the third century AD. However, both archaeologists are confused by its design, which consists of elements of two ancient civilizations: Teotihuacan and El Tajin.
The construction of the Great Pyramid is similar to a Russian matryoshka: one pyramid is located inside another as if it was completed at different times. Its total volume is more than 3 million cubic meters. Its height reaches 70 meters. Moreover, each of its sides has a length of about 400 meters. Inside the pyramid is a network of tunnels more than 8 kilometers long. And a Spanish church was built in 1666 on its top. You can climb to the top of the hill, which offers a magnificent view of Cholula and Puebla. You can use the staircase which is completely cleared of vegetation.
Archaeologists discovered the pyramid in 1910 as a result of landslides after heavy rains. Later, they excavated the staircases, platforms, and altars of the pyramid. Huge frescoes measuring more than 50 meters as well as full-size stone figures of people were found. For so many years, it had been hidden from human sight by dense bushes and grass. The locals mistook it for an ordinary hill. Today, the Great Pyramid is considered a truly precious monument of pre-Columbian America and the largest pyramid in the world.
